Charlotte Ferguson McSparran of the Quarryville Presbyterian Retirement Community died on Wednesday, December 11, 2013. She was 93. Mrs. McSparran was born in Quarryville, a daughter of the late Ellis E. and Lottie M. Shaub Ferguson. She lived in Peach Bottom before moving to the retirement community six years ago. She graduated from Quarryville High School and Drexel College. Mrs. McSparran worked with her parents at Ferguson & Hassler's store and the former Ferguson's Dress shop, both in Quarryville. She worked with her husband on the family's dairy farm and traveled with him during his years with Mid-Atlantic Milk Cooperative. The couple also prepared taxes for many in the community. Mrs. McSparran was a member of Chestnut Level Presbyterian Church and the Order of the Eastern Star.
